The local picture

North York is in the middle of a slow rebuild. Willowdale, Bayview Village and Lansing are full of 1950s bungalows on generous lots, and a steady share of them are being replaced with large custom homes. That produces two very different kinds of painting work happening on the same street.

Housing stock

1950s–60s bungalows across Willowdale, Bathurst Manor and Downsview, large post-2010 custom rebuilds infilling the same neighbourhoods, and dense condo towers along the Yonge corridor.

What shapes a North York quote

  • 01

    New custom builds need a new-drywall spec

    Fresh board is highly absorbent and needs a genuine primer coat, not a thinned first finish coat. Getting this wrong on a new build shows up as patchy sheen within weeks.

  • 02

    Post-war bungalow prep

    Original stock carries plaster, oil trim and textured ceilings. Each needs its own decision, and all three are commonly mishandled by crews used to newer housing.

  • 03

    Yonge corridor condo packages

    Towers between Sheppard and Finch run the standard set: COI, elevator booking, restricted hours, damage deposit.

We just finished a custom build. Does new drywall need primer?

Yes, and a real one. Fresh drywall and fresh joint compound are two different levels of absorbency sitting next to each other on the same wall. Skip the primer and the finish coat soaks into the compound differently from the board, so the joints read as dull bands through the paint, a defect that shows up within weeks and cannot be fixed without priming and repainting the whole wall. A thinned first finish coat is not a substitute for a drywall primer sealer.

Our reno added new drywall next to old plaster. Will you see the join?

Not if it is handled properly, and very obviously if it is not. The two substrates have different porosity and different surface texture, so the transition has to be skimmed to a single plane and then the whole wall primed uniformly. If someone paints straight over the join, you will see the boundary as a change in sheen for as long as that paint is on the wall.
